>< A far more important issue is that of X.400 addresses which when 
>< encapsulated in uucp using `/' as a delimiter get bounced by the
>< security code in HDB uucp.
 
> Install smail 3.1.19, and use BSMTP as transport.

You also have to persuade ukc (UK national backbone) to support b-smtp.

UKC runs MMDF.  I doubt anyone could get them to change their mailer
except possibly to PP sometime in the future.  Then again, PP is MMDF III
isn't it ? :-)

Has anyone done BSMTP support for MMDF ?  Also, please be aware that ukc
runs update #21 MMDF (probably with local hacks :-)

I have; however, it's basically hacked-together, consisting of two Perl
script, one small program to get MMDF to format a message for a particular
channel, and some library patches to MMDF to make said small program work
without segemntation faults. The receiving side can be used as is, however.

One other remark: smail 3.1.19 also doesn't like /s in addresses.
(Someone else please post an appropriate patch; I'm using MMDF.)
